Student removed from metro Atlanta school after making threats to shoot another student

COWETA COUNTY, Ga. — School threats continue as a metro Atlanta middle school say they removed a student from campus after he threatened to shoot another student. On Friday, East Coweta Middle School Principal Chad Kollert sent a letter to parents informing them of the removal of a student. According to Kollert, just after 11 a. m.

Friday morning, a student made a verbal threat to shoot another student, in the midst of a conversation with the student in class.
